The lawsuit is legally a waste of paper, hasn't a chance in hell. What political benefit may come of I would not venture to guess.

Clinton wasn't convicted of anything. Or criminally charged with anything.

The "high crimes and misdemenors" language in the impeachment clause of the US Const. is undefined, and needn't mean crime in the statutory sense. Really it means whatever Congress says it means, since the S.Ct is unlikely to infere in the conflict bewteen coordinate branches.

Perjury rules don't apply to bar sanctions -- he was ultimately disbarred, or forced to resign his law license to avoid oficial discipline, because it's a disciplinary violation in Arkansas, as elsewhere, for a lawyer to lie to a federal judge. Or any judge. Bar discipline on that ground happens ALL the time.

Is lying to a federal judge grounds for impeachment? Should it be? I think not. Though I don't recommend to a lawyer. I think impeachable conduct ought to be really bad, like covering up a burglary. Or lying to justify an illegal war. But I don't make the rules.

Does it matter, constitutionally, politically, that Congress and the GOP declared war on the President and tried to bring him down by foul means or worse? Yes, of course it does. It debased our already debased politics even further and besmirched the Republic, which I, at least, care about.
